Veterinary Surgeon – Small Animal near Corby

All candidates should make sure to read the following job description and information carefully before applying.

Are you a dedicated Veterinary Surgeon seeking a role with a mix of consultations and surgical procedures? Our client is looking for a talented individual to join their compassionate and experienced team. This busy small animal practice offers a varied caseload, including first opinion services and orthopaedic work, in a supportive environment.

What’s on offer:

  • Offering up to Β£75,000.00 DOE
  • Flexible schedules (Part time or Full time)
  • Shared Saturday rota
  • Relocation allowance
  • Welcome bonus up
  • Well-equipped with consultation rooms, theatre, imaging room, in-house lab, and kennels/cattery facilities.
  • Supported by vets, RVNs, ANA, and receptionists
  • A collaborative, friendly team dedicated to high standards of care

Benefits include:

  • 6.6 weeks annual leave (incl. bank holidays) + birthday leave
  • Private Medical Insurance
  • CPD allowance + 40 hours paid leave
  • BVA, VDS and RCVS covered
  • Company pension
  • Cycle to Work scheme
